Understanding The Power-saving Modes On Your Computer

Understanding the power-saving modes on your computer is essential to effectively wake it up using the keyboard. Computers have several power-saving modes, including sleep, hibernate, and hybrid sleep. In sleep mode, the computer enters a low-power state, suspending most activities but still using a minimal amount of power. In hibernate mode, the computer saves the current state to the hard drive and shuts down completely, using no power. Hybrid sleep combines the features of sleep and hibernate modes, allowing the computer to quickly resume from sleep mode but also providing the safety net of hibernation in case of power loss.

Troubleshooting Common Issues With Keyboard Wake-up

Troubleshooting common issues with keyboard wake-up can be incredibly frustrating, especially when you’re in a rush to use your computer. However, there are a few simple steps you can take to diagnose and fix the problem swiftly.

One of the first things you should do is check your computer’s power settings. Sometimes, the keyboard wake-up option may be disabled or not properly configured. Head to the power settings menu in your operating system and ensure that keyboard wake-up is enabled.

Another common issue could be related to your keyboard itself. Make sure that it’s properly connected to your computer and that there are no loose connections. If you’re using a wireless keyboard, ensure that the batteries are not dead and that the keyboard is within range of the receiver.

If the above steps don’t solve the problem, you may need to update or reinstall your keyboard drivers. Outdated or corrupted drivers can often cause issues with wake-up functionality. Visit your keyboard manufacturer’s website to download the latest drivers and follow their instructions for installation.
